International Journal of New Political Economy is an open access double-blind peer-reviewed semiannually journal, owned, managed, and published by Shahid Beheshti University since 2020. The journal publishes original full-length articles, reviews, and letters relevant to political economy including law, sociology and the like to publish their theoretical and practical research in the field of economics, politics and political economy.
